Victory Park Capital Bolsters Legal Credit Team as Maleson Expands Role to Managing Director

June 17, 2025, 07:45 AM

Victory Park Capital (“VPC”), a leading global alternative investment firm specializing in private credit, announced that Justin Maleson has expanded his role to Managing Director of the firm’s legal credit investment strategy. Maleson, who joined VPC in 2024 as Assistant General Counsel, will co-head the strategy with Chad Clamage, Managing Director and work closely Hugo Lestiboudois and Andrew Pascal who are dedicated to the strategy.  Richard Levy, VPC CEO, CIO & Founder will continue to oversee the strategy.

“Justin is the perfect fit to help lead and expand our legal credit strategy,” said Levy. “He has a wealth of experience in operating within this space, and he demonstrates a deep understanding of how the firm’s strategy can meet the financing needs of the legal industry and drive value for our investors. We look forward to his contributions to our legal credit team.”

In his expanded role, Maleson will be responsible for sourcing, analyzing, executing, and managing investments within the legal industry. He is a member of the firm’s Legal Credit Investment Committee. Mr. Maleson also assists with oversight of the firm’s legal operations in his role as Assistant General Counsel.

VPC’s legal credit team is comprised of veteran litigators, legal finance investors, and seasoned private credit professionals. The firm takes an asset-backed lending approach to the legal asset class, emphasizing downside protection and current income streams. With its deep expertise and extensive industry relationships, VPC is well-positioned to capitalize on market inefficiencies and pursue opportunities across the full spectrum of legal asset types and structures while creating resilience against market volatility and delivering long-term value for investors.

“VPC is a trusted, sophisticated credit provider with a proven track record in the legal credit space,” Maleson said. “I look forward to working with the rest of the team to build a thoughtfully diversified portfolio of asset-backed legal assets, underpinned by the firm’s disciplined investment process and rigorous risk management framework.”

Previously, Maleson was a director at Longford Capital, where he was responsible for originating litigation finance opportunities, conducting due diligence, and managing commercial investments. Before that, he was a litigation partner at Jenner & Block, where he advised and represented clients on an array of complex and high-value commercial and intellectual property matters in the U.S. and abroad. Maleson is an active member of the Illinois Bar.
